Gloria "Glo" Jean Bowman

July 29, 1948 — July 6, 2024

Homer

Gloria “Glo” Jean Bowman,75, of Homer passed peacefully into the arms of the Lord on July 6, 2024. Gloria was a devoted Christian and battled two decades of chronic progressive Multiple Sclerosis from which she succumbed to her disease.

Gloria was born to Bernard Eppley and Virginia (Williams) Jolly on July 29, 1948 in Zanesville, Ohio. On May 27, 1977 Gloria married James Bowman and shortly thereafter they moved to Michigan.

Gloria was a registered Nurse for 30 years, working at Litchfield Manor, Marshall Manor and was especially proud of being a certified OB Nurse at Albion Hospital. In the mid 1990’s, Gloria opened and managed Beach Glo Tanning Salon for several years in downtown Homer.

Her hobbies included league bowling, flower gardening and shopping. She also dabbled in hunting and was lucky enough to shoot a 10-point buck. Due to the progression of her disease, she was unable to walk and found her talent in cross stitching. She kept busy with puzzles, adult coloring books and scrapbooking. Gloria was known to buzz around in her motor chair getting into trouble.

She was proud of her family and loved her Siamese cats. Her disease caused her to become bed bound later in which she enjoyed devouring books on her kindle and playing games on her phone. Gloria also loved to beat the grandkids in her favorite card game Skip Bo.
